文档介绍:实验二 SQL语言的基本操作
【实验目的】
掌握利用SQL语句完成各种查询操作的能力。
【实验学时】
10学时
【实验类型】
综合型
【实验环境】
SQL Server2005
【实验人数】
1人/组
【实验内容及要求】
用SQL语句和企业管理器建立如下的表结构并输入数据
给定表结构如下:
学生表:student(主键Sno)
学号
Sno
姓名
Sname
性别
Ssex
年龄
Sage
所在系
Sdept
95001
李勇
男
20
CS
95002
刘晨
女
21
IS
95003
王敏
女
18
MA
95004
张力
男
19
IS
课程表:Course(o)
课程号
Cno
课程名
Cname
先行课
Cpno
学分
Ccredit
1
数据库
5
4
2
数学
2
3
信息系统
1
4
4
操作系统
6
3
5
数据结构
7
4
6
数据处理
2
7
PASCAL语言
6
4
选课表:SC(o,o)
学号
Sno
课程表
Cno
成绩
Grade
95001
1
92
95001
2
85
95001
3
88
95002
2
90
95002
3
85
95003
3
59
用SQL语句完成一下的要求:
create database information
create table Student
(Sno varchar(10) primary key ,
Sname nvarchar(10) ,
Ssex nvarchar(2) ,
Sage int ,
Sdept varchar(10)
)
insert into Student values('95001','李勇','男','20','CS')
insert into Student values('95002','刘晨','女','21','IS')
insert into Student values('95003','王敏','女','18','MA')
insert into Student values('95004','张力','男','19','IS')
create table Course
(Cno varchar(10) primary key ,
Cname nvarchar(10) ,
Cpno nvarchar(10) ,
Ccredit int
)
insert into Course values('1','数据库','5','4')
insert into Course values('2','数学','','2')
insert into Course values('3','信息系统','1','4')
insert into Course values('4','操作系统','6','3')
insert into Course values('5','数据结构','7','4')
insert in